    I thought my guns didn't have good sights, Or the scope, Or the trigger pull, Something was preventing me from being a good shooter,
    Yes I have a nice Garand, O3A3, Carbine and other assorted flavors,,,,,,,
    All the while it was me that the sights were off,
    I promise you that if you shoot a thousand rounds from a low recoil firearm like the Smith and Wesson model 17, You will shoot the 44 with expertise,
    You buy and shoot a 44 Mag 100 times, Ill still outshoot you one handed,,,
    No matter what you buy, Best to buy something reliable and to me a collectable, You wont wear out an older Smith and Wesson revolver and will sell it for more than you paid 5 years down the line,,,
    I will say that I do love my 500 magnum, But without my model 17 I may not be the shooter I am today,
    Plus 500 rounds for $50 these days,
    Thats a lot of shooting for the $$$.

    Six years ago, I bought a police surplus 38 Special S&W Model 10 on Gunbroker for $299. It has the best stock trigger of any gun I've ever picked up. It's accurate, and a LOT cheaper to shoot than a .44 Magnum. If I had to pick just one revolver, that would be it.
